CVE-2017-0441
HighSummary
CVE-2017-0441 is a privilege escalation vulnerability in the Qualcomm Wi-Fi driver that allows a local malicious application to execute arbitrary code within the kernel context. This issue is rated as High because it first requires compromising a privileged process.
Risk Assessment
This vulnerability could lead to full control over the Android operating system, posing significant risks to user data security and system integrity.
Recommendation
It is recommended to update the Android system to the latest version to mitigate the risks associated with this vulnerability and to monitor installed applications on devices.

Original NVD description (English source)
An elevation of privilege vulnerability in the Qualcomm Wi-Fi driver could enable a local malicious application to execute arbitrary code within the context of the kernel. This issue is rated as High because it first requires compromising a privileged process. Product: Android. Versions: Kernel-3.10, Kernel-3.18. Android ID: A-32872662. References: QC-CR#1095009.
